Demographics details for Klamath falls, OR vs Latah, WA

Population Overview

Compare main population characteristics in Klamath falls, OR vs Latah, WA.

Data Klamath falls Latah
Population 21,977 176
Median Age 35.1 years 40.0 years
Median Income $46,695 $46,563
Married Families 31.0% 23.0%
Poverty Level 18% Data is updating
Unemployment Rate 5.2 4.5

Population Comparison: Klamath falls vs Latah

  • In Klamath falls, the population is higher at 21,977, compared to 176 in Latah.
  • The median age in Latah is higher at 40.0 years, compared to 35.1 years in Klamath falls.
  • Klamath falls has a higher median income of $46,695 compared to $46,563 in Latah.
  • A higher percentage of married families is found in Klamath falls at 31.0% compared to 23.0% in Latah.
  • Klamath falls has a higher poverty level at 18% compared to 0% in Latah.
  • The unemployment rate in Klamath falls is higher at 5.2%, compared to 4.5% in Latah.
